The dies that have been used to make the cards in the video are:

Spellbinders Nestabilities Mega Dies, Labels 20

Spellbinders Mega Dies, Parisian Motifs

Spellbinders Parisian Accents

Spellbinders Edgeabilities, Classic Bracket

Spellbinders Spiral Blossom One

Spellbinders Shapeabilities Dies, Foliage

Spellbinders Grand Impressabilities Flower Delight Template

 

Remember, with everything you do there are alternatives.  If you don’t have the appropriate die, but have something similar, you can use that.  Sure, the result will be a little different, but you will have something uniquely yours.

The dies mentioned above are all good dies to have in your collection, so if you don’t have them, it’s worth thinking about. (I have some of these dies, but not all.  I will be building my collection with these dies in the near future.)

To use the dies, you will need a Cuttlebug Machine or similar die cutting machine.  If you would like to see the differences between the various die cutting machines, check out this site.
